3. Controller and processor roles

BizPilot's role depends upon the relevant processing activity.

Where BizPilot determines the purposes and means of processing relating to its own accounts; subscriptions; billing; security; fraud prevention; support; service analytics; marketing; legal compliance; and business administration, BizPilot may act as a controller.

Where a Customer uses BizPilot to process personal data relating to employees, contractors, applicants, customers, guests or other individuals for purposes determined by the Customer, the Customer will generally act as controller and BizPilot as processor. Where BizPilot acts as processor, processing will be governed by the applicable Data Processing Addendum or other legally appropriate contractual arrangement.

5. Lawful bases

Where BizPilot acts as controller, our lawful basis will depend upon the processing. It may include:

  • Contract — processing necessary to enter into or perform a contract.
  • Legal obligation — processing required to comply with applicable law.
  • Legitimate interests — processing necessary for legitimate interests where those interests are not overridden by applicable individual rights and interests. Potential legitimate interests include securing BizPilot, preventing fraud, providing support, maintaining reliable services, administering commercial relationships and protecting legal rights.
  • Consent — where consent is the appropriate basis.
  • Other lawful bases may apply where permitted.

    6. Special-category data

    Where special-category data is processed, an appropriate Article 6 lawful basis and applicable additional condition must exist. Customers remain responsible for ensuring their use of such information is lawful.

    12. International transfers

    BizPilot is operated by an Australian company and may use international service providers. Where UK personal data is transferred internationally and a safeguard is required, BizPilot will use an appropriate lawful transfer mechanism. This may include applicable adequacy regulations, approved contractual safeguards, the UK International Data Transfer Agreement, an applicable UK Addendum or another legally permitted mechanism.
